[. . . ] Even if the amplifier's power output is lower than the speakers' power capacity, the speakers may be damaged when clipping of a high input signal occurs. The following may cause damage to speakers: - Feedback caused when using a microphone. - Continuous high sound pressure level produced by electronic instruments. [. . . ] When turning the power off, the power amplifier should be turned off FIRST for the same reason. · Do not operate this device at high volume levels or at a level that is uncomfortable, since it is capable of producing sound levels that could cause permanent hearing loss. If you experience any discomfort or ringing in the ears, or suspect an hearing loss, you should consult an audiologist. Eye bolt strength Keep in mind that the strength of the eye bolt differs depending on the suspension angle of the speaker. Make sure that the load for each eye bolt is less than 740 kg when suspending at an angle of 0 degrees, and less than 185 kg at an angle of 45 degrees.
